    IP Address Format

    Register Format: 1st Register High byte: IP Address 1st Octet 1st Register Low byte: IP Address 2nd Octet 2nd Register High byte: IP Address 3rd Octet 2nd Register Low byte: IP Address 4th Octet

    Range: 000.000.000.000 to 255.255.255.255
